If you want to land these jobs faster, you can do another degree once you get your Bachelor’s.
For what reason would you take a master’s degree? For one, when you present one to an employer, you have an appeal.
If you get your CPAs, you immediately increase yourself on the rankings of an employer, as compared to someone who did not do his CPAs. People normally have a casual approach towards CPAs. They see them as stuff that can be done later on in life. That makes them loose out.
To put you on the same wavelength, all you need to do is show that you are well prepared for the interview.
Take advantage of job search engines. You can register for free as soon as possible and you will be ready to go. All you have to do is be consistent with them. That ensures that you do not see an opportunity too late. You could be lucky the next time you log in. you can as well stumble on a company that’s recruiting currently.
